monday.com is growing and looking for a Channel Partner Manager to manage our partners in Italy and Greece. This role includes managing all relationships and sales efforts with our channel partners, including direct client-facing responsibilities, mainly for strategic business. The channel manager is responsible for the constant growth of their partners' businesses and teams and for managing them together with their pipeline and forecasts. The role may also include developing channel relationships from scratch. This role will be based in our office in Tel Aviv.

  • Minimum 3-4 years of experience in SaaS sales roles - must.
  • Fluency in Italian and/or Greek - an advantage.
  • 1+ years’ experience in managing Channel Partners/ Resellers - an advantage.
  • Strong sales background - with a track record - from the opportunity to close.
  • Account and quota planning skills.
  • Ability to take an entire project from A to Z.
  • Strong relationship builder, initiator, and outstanding verbal and written communication skills.
  • Exceptional organisational and multitasking skills.
  • Team player with a super proactive approach.
  • Strength and experience with public speaking - an advantage.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
